Essential Guide to Wiring for Downlights: Step-by-Step Instructions

Downlights, also known as recessed lights or can lights, are a popular lighting option for both residential and commercial spaces. These fixtures are installed into the ceiling, providing a sleek and modern lighting solution that can illuminate specific areas or provide ambient lighting. Downlights come in various sizes, shapes, and designs, allowing for versatile use in different settings.

They are often used to highlight specific features in a room, such as artwork or architectural details, and can also be used for general illumination. Downlights typically consist of a housing, a trim, and a bulb. The housing is the part that is installed into the ceiling, while the trim is the visible part of the fixture that sits flush with the ceiling.

The bulb, which can be LED, halogen, or incandescent, provides the actual light source. LED downlights are particularly popular due to their energy efficient nature. The benefits of LED lighting include reduced heat generation, prolonged usage time, and enhanced safety compared to traditional fixtures. Downlights are known for their ability to create a clean and uncluttered look in a space, as they do not protrude from the ceiling like traditional light fixtures.

Understanding Downlights

Downlights are a type of recessed lighting fixture that is installed directly into the ceiling, providing a sleek and modern look. They are designed to illuminate a specific area, making them ideal for task lighting, ambient lighting, or accent lighting. Downlights are available in various types, including LED downlights, recessed spotlights, and fire-rated downlights.

LED downlights are particularly popular due to their energy efficiency and long lifespan. They consume less power compared to traditional incandescent or halogen bulbs, making them a cost-effective and environmentally friendly option. Recessed spotlights, on the other hand, are perfect for highlighting specific areas or features in a room, such as artwork or architectural details. Fire-rated downlights are designed to maintain the integrity of fire-resistant ceilings, providing an added layer of safety in case of a fire.

Tools and Materials Needed for Wiring Downlights

Introduction to Downlight Wiring

Before embarking on the wiring process for downlights, it’s essential to gather the necessary tools and materials. The tools required typically include a power drill, a hole saw or drywall saw for creating openings in the ceiling, wire strippers, a voltage tester, and screwdrivers. Additionally, it’s important to have access to a ladder or step stool to reach the ceiling safely.

Necessary Materials for Installing Downlights

In terms of materials, the key components include the downlights themselves, electrical wire (usually 1mm² twin and earth cable), junction boxes or connectors, insulation tape, and cable clips for securing the wiring. It’s crucial to ensure that all materials are suitable for use in the specific environment where the downlights will be installed. Additionally, using fire hoods is important to mitigate fire risks associated with recessed downlights and to comply with building regulations.

Environmental Considerations for Downlight Installation

For example, if the downlights are intended for use in bathrooms or outdoor areas, it’s important to select fixtures and wiring that are rated for moisture resistance. This will help ensure that the downlights function safely and efficiently in their intended environment.

Planning and Preparation: Key Steps Before Wiring Downlights

Before diving into the wiring process, thorough planning and preparation are essential for a successful downlight installation. This includes determining the placement of the downlights to achieve optimal lighting coverage and ensuring that there are no obstructions such as joists or pipes in the ceiling where the fixtures will be installed. It is crucial to remove any existing lighting feature to ensure a seamless integration of the new downlights. It’s also important to consider the type of switch or dimmer that will control the downlights and plan for its installation.

Another crucial aspect of planning is ensuring that the electrical circuit can accommodate the additional load of the new downlights. This may involve consulting with a qualified electrician to assess the existing wiring and make any necessary upgrades to the electrical system. Determining how many downlights are needed is also vital for effective lighting. Factors such as the desired lighting effect, the size of the room, and the placement of focal points should be considered. Additionally, obtaining any required permits or approvals from local building authorities should be addressed before commencing with the installation.

Installing Downlights

Installing downlights requires careful planning and attention to detail to ensure a safe and successful installation. Before starting the installation process, it’s essential to assess your lighting needs and determine the number of downlights required. A general rule of thumb is to install one downlight per square meter, but this may vary depending on the desired lighting effect and beam angle.

When installing downlights, it’s crucial to follow the manufacturer’s instructions and take necessary safety precautions. This includes turning off the power at the electrical control box, using a wire tester to ensure there is no voltage present, and wearing protective gear such as gloves and safety glasses.

To install a downlight, start by marking the center point of the light on the ceiling and drilling a small pilot hole. Use a hole saw or plasterboard saw to create a clean cut hole, and then pull the wiring through the hole. Connect the wires to the downlight, making sure to match the white and uninsulated wires. Use wire tape to secure the connections, and then fit the downlight into place using the spring-loaded metal clips.

Finally, turn the power back on and test the downlight to ensure it’s working correctly. If you’re installing multiple downlights, repeat the process for each light, making sure to space them evenly apart to achieve the desired lighting effect. This method ensures that your downlights are securely installed and provide the brighter lighting you’re aiming for.

Step-by-Step Guide to Fitting Downlights

The process of fitting downlights and wiring them involves several sequential steps to ensure safe and effective installation. Firstly, the power supply to the area where the downlights will be installed must be turned off at the circuit breaker to prevent any electrical hazards. Recessed downlights offer a versatile and space-saving lighting solution, particularly beneficial in kitchens and bathrooms, and require careful planning to achieve the desired lighting effect.

Next, holes are carefully cut into the ceiling at the predetermined locations for the downlights using a hole saw or drywall saw.

Once the openings are made, the electrical wiring is routed from the power source to each downlight location, ensuring that there is sufficient slack in the wiring to make connections. The wiring is then connected to each downlight using appropriate connectors or junction boxes, following the manufacturer’s instructions for proper installation. After all connections are made, the downlights are secured into the ceiling and the trim pieces are attached to complete the installation.

Safety Precautions and Tips for Wiring Downlights

When working with electrical wiring for downlights, safety should always be a top priority. It’s crucial to follow all relevant safety guidelines and regulations, including wearing appropriate personal protective equipment such as gloves and safety glasses. Additionally, using a voltage tester to ensure that power is completely shut off before beginning any work is essential to prevent electrical shocks.

Furthermore, it’s important to avoid overloading electrical circuits by ensuring that the total wattage of the downlights does not exceed the capacity of the circuit. This may require consulting with an electrician to assess the load on the circuit and make any necessary adjustments. Proper insulation and securing of wiring using cable clips can help prevent potential hazards such as short circuits or exposed wires.

Troubleshooting Common Issues with Downlight Wiring

Flickering Lights: Causes and Solutions

Flickering lights may indicate voltage fluctuations or incompatible dimmer switches. To resolve this issue, try adjusting the dimmer settings or use dimmable LED bulbs specifically designed for use with dimmer switches.

Uneven Illumination: Causes and Solutions

Uneven illumination can be caused by improper placement of the downlights or incorrect bulb wattage. To achieve more uniform lighting, adjust the positioning of the fixtures or use bulbs with appropriate beam angles.

General Troubleshooting Steps

In addition to addressing specific issues, general troubleshooting steps can help identify and resolve downlight wiring problems. These steps include checking for loose connections, ensuring proper grounding of the fixtures, and verifying that the correct type of bulb is being used.

Final Touches: Testing and Finishing the Downlight Wiring Installation

Once all downlights are wired and installed, thorough testing is essential to ensure that everything functions as intended. This includes turning on the power supply and checking each fixture for proper illumination without any flickering or dimming issues. Additionally, testing the functionality of any dimmer switches or other control mechanisms is important to verify seamless operation.

After successful testing, any excess wiring should be neatly secured and tucked away in the ceiling cavity using cable clips to prevent potential hazards or aesthetic issues. Finally, applying insulation tape to secure wire connections and sealing any gaps around the fixtures with appropriate sealant can help ensure a tidy and professional finish to the downlight wiring installation.
